FAQs
Who can refer a patient to CABHH?
Anyone can make a referral; primary sources are county social service agencies, hospitals, outpatient providers, schools, parents, and the courts.
Admission criteria?
Admits only patients who meet the medical criteria for hospitalization; admission criteria differ from non-acute care residential facilities; pre-admission screening and medical/mental health professional referral required.
Visiting policy?
Visits require advance scheduling; visits coordinated with family, etc.; privacy and release forms apply.

Summary: Community Health Service Inc. (CHS), a private nonprofit network of primary care clinics founded in 1973, provides quality healthcare across Minnesota and North Dakota. Headquartered in Moorhead, MN, CHS serves a broad community and has an office in Willmar, MN (Willmar address: 1804 Trott Ave SW, Willmar, MN 56201). CHS began to serve migrant agricultural workers and now offers expanded services through eight U.S. locations, including Willmar.
